I wouldn't go back that far to 2004, because market sentimen has changed. This EA is not safe in the sense that when market sentimen changed, and the retraction wasn't generate enough profit, it will not able to close off the piled up positions. The test I did was 2006 ~ present, and they looks good. ?Now, the reason you get bigger lot size is because you let the money management set to TRUE. Turn it off inorder to use your prespecified lot size, or the EA will decide the lot size according to your account balance.
